LC-2
LC-2 is a VHL-based PROTAC that covalently engages endogenous KRAS G12C via MRTX849 to induce its targeted degradation (DC50 ~0.25-0.76 μM) and suppress MAPK signaling. This tool compound is used in vitro for oncology research, particularly in studying KRAS-driven cancers and targeted protein degradation.
